Avaliação de risco ambiental por contaminação metálica e material orgânico em sedimentos da bacia do Rio Aurá, Região Metropolitana de Belém - PA

Abstract: A bacia do Rio Aurá está situada na região metropolitana de Belém, entre os municípios de Belém e Ananindeua, onde a taxa populacional tem aumentado sem qualquer medida de controle social ou ambiental. A região é intensamente explorada, sendo que os principais problemas ambientais são o desmatamento, erosão, inundação, poluição e contaminação das águas, especialmente por metais pesados e compostos orgânicos. “…In another study in the Aurá River basin, the mean level of total Cu in the sediments was 19.57±4.52 mg kg -1 (Siqueira;Aprile, 2013). This result reinforces the idea that the dump is contributing to the contamination of the site by Cu, most likely because the metal is leaching from the soil to the water source.…”
